The goals of the crime prevention and code enforcement committee are
- to work in conjunction with our South End neighbors to ensure that quality of life issues are top priority
- to work closely with the City of West Palm Beach police department to help decrease ongoing negative activities, i.e. prostitution, drug trafficking, and home intrusions such as burglaries
- to distribute monthly police reports tracking illegal activity throughout the entire neighborhood
- to work in unison with city Code Enforcement Officers and residents to identify and cure various city code violations
